This Executive Deployment Report documents an Azure security configuration for MedCore Health Services built around
three administrative outcomes: least-privilege access through group-based Azure RBAC, centralized cryptographic control
through Azure Key Vault and customer-managed keys, and automated recovery through Azure Backup. The configuration
supports the hybrid security architecture proposed in Task 1 while producing auditable evidence for identity, encryption, and
continuity controls.
The representative deployment uses resource groups to constrain scope, Microsoft Entra security groups to represent job
functions, Azure RBAC to separate management-plane and data-plane permissions, a production Key Vault with Azure
RBAC authorization, soft delete and purge protection, and a Recovery Services vault configured for geo-redundant backup.
All names, schedules, roles, and recovery objectives must be reconciled with the current WGU lab scenario before
submission.

Predeployment Control Gates
• Confirm the exact users, departments, auditor role, target resources, backup time, retention duration, and region in the
official scenario.
• Use only the assigned lab tenant and subscription. Do not configure a personal or production tenant for this assessment.
• Record the original state before making changes and retain an activity log or deployment history.
• Never place passwords, secret values, recovery codes, tokens, connection strings, or patient information in screenshots.
• Capture evidence only after validation succeeds; keep the whole desktop visible if the rubric requires system clock, date,
and taskbar.
